The prices of petrol and diesel are continuously increasing in the country, causing concern among the public. As a result, people are turning to electric vehicles (EVs) as an alternative.

However, EVs are generally more expensive than their petrol and diesel counterparts. If you are on a budget, there is a solution. Several companies in the market specialize in converting existing petrol and diesel cars into electric cars, offering a more affordable option.

Conversion Process and Cost

Converting an ordinary car into an electric car typically costs around Rs 4-5 lakh. The price depends on the wattage of the motor installed in the vehicle. Most conversion companies are based in Hyderabad and are involved in manufacturing electric vehicle parts.

The process involves installing a motor, controller, roller, and battery to transform a regular car into an electric one. The higher the wattage of the motor and battery, the higher the expense. For example, installing a 20 kW electric motor and a 12 kW lithium-ion battery could cost up to Rs 4 lakh.

Cost Comparison

Comparing the cost per kilometer, we can take the example of the Tata Nexon, which offers petrol, diesel, and electric options.

The petrol and diesel variants have a mileage of 16-22 kilometers per liter. Assuming a petrol price of Rs 100 per liter and a mileage of 16 kmpl, the cost per kilometer is 6.25 paise.

For diesel priced at Rs 95 per liter and a mileage of 22 kilometers, the cost per kilometer is Rs 4.31. In contrast, the Tata Nexon EV consumes 30.2 units of electricity for a full charge.

Assuming an electricity rate of Rs 6 per unit, the cost to fully charge it is Rs 181.2, allowing it to run approximately 300 kilometers. Therefore, the cost per kilometer is 60 paise.
